For my second card I used my TCW
stencil and pinched some paste my
OH had made. I mixed a bit of alcohol
ink with it and pasted it on the stencil.
I then used a few drops of 3 colours of
alcohol inks on top of the paste. When
that was dry I sprayed some silver
ink over it all.
I edged the topper with a silver pen,
then added a stamped sentiment and
a few sequins. I stamped the butterfly,
gave that a quick silver spray too, then
gave it the same alcohol ink treatment
also. A tiny bit of sparkle was added
later to the wings.
